Grilled Bacon Wrapped Corn On The Cob
If you're a fan of corn on the cob, you'll love this tasty twist on a classic. Grilled bacon-wrapped corn on the cob is a delicious dish that combines the sweetness of fresh corn with the salty, savory flavor of bacon. It's easy to make, and perfect for any summer barbecue or cookout. In this article, we'll show you how to make grilled bacon-wrapped corn on the cob, step by step.
Ingredients
For this recipe, you'll need the following:
- 6 ears of fresh corn
- 6 strips of bacon
- 1/4 cup of unsalted butter
- 2 tablespoons of chopped fresh parsley
- 1 tablespoon of gar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on of paprika
- Salt and pepper to taste
Directions
Follow these simple steps to make grilled bacon-wrapped corn on the cob:
-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
- Peel back the husks of each ear of corn, but do not remove them. Remove the silk and then tie the husks back with kitchen string.
- Wrap each ear of corn with a strip of bacon, starting at the top and wrapping it around the ear, slightly overlapping each turn.
- In a small saucepan, melt the butter over low heat. Add the chopped parsley,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per, and stir until combined.
- Place the bacon-wrapped corn on the grill and cook for 10-12 minutes, turning occasionally, until the bacon is crispy and the corn is tender.
- When the corn is done, remove it from the grill and brush it generously with the butter mixture.
- Serve immediately and enjoy!
Tips and Tricks
Here are a few tips to make sure your grilled bacon-wrapped corn on the cob turns out perfectly:
- Use fresh corn for the best flavor.
- When wrapping the bacon around the corn, try to cover as much of the cob as possible, so that the bacon cooks evenly.
- Make sure to turn the corn frequently on the grill, so that the bacon doesn't burn.
- The butter mixture can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ator until you're ready to use it.
